Chelsea book medical for Super Eagles-eligible player ahead of completing transfer
Published: August 08, 2024
Chelsea are set to schedule a medical examination for Super Eagles-eligible player Samu Omorodion as they prepare to finalize his transfer from Atletico Madrid.
The Blues have reportedly secured the Nigerian-born striker's signature in a deal valued at £34.5 million and he is expected to sign a seven-year contract with the Premier League club following the medical.
Transfer market expert Fabrizio Romano shared on X that Chelsea are pushing to book the medical in Paris today.
Chelsea are aiming to wrap up the transfer after nearly a month of negotiations with Atletico Madrid.
Once the deal is completed, Omorodion will compete for a spot alongside Nicolas Jackson, Christopher Nkunku, and Marc Guiu, a young talent recently signed from Barcelona.
Omorodion is currently participating in the 2024 Olympics with Spain in France.
The 20-year-old forward made a brief appearance in Spain's 2-1 victory over Morocco, securing their place in the Olympic final.
Throughout the tournament, Omorodion has made four appearances and scored in the group-stage match against Egypt.
His impressive performances at Alaves, where he played on loan from Atletico Madrid, caught Chelsea's attention.
Omorodion scored eight goals and provided one assist in 34 La Liga games, sparking interest from several top European clubs including Chelsea and Bayer Leverkusen.
